Mar 7, 2022 · Here are the pros of buying preferred stock ETFs: Higher dividends: Compared to common stock, preferred stock will usually pay greater dividends. Preference in bankruptcy: Preferred stocks are ahead of common stocks (but behind bonds) in order of liquidation if there is a bankruptcy proceeding. Preferred stock, a kind of hybrid security that has characteristics of both debt and equity, is attracting more interest from investors who are seeking higher yielding investments in the current low interest rate environment. Mainly issued by financial institutions, preferreds have several advantages as well as some risks to be aware of.When a private company goes public, it begins selling equity in the company in the form of shares of stock, which are traded on the stock market.
